So also was Jonah among those sent (by Us). 139 When he ran away (like a slave from captivity) to the ship (fully) laden, 140 And then drew lots and was of those rejected; 141 The fish then swallowed him and he blamed himself. (For not waiting for Allah’s command.) 142 Had he not been of them who glorify Allah, 143 He would have remained in its belly till the day when all will be raised. 144 ۞ But We cast him forth on the naked shore while he was sick, 145 and We caused a gourd tree to grow over him. 146 And We sent him (on a mission) to a hundred thousand (men) or more. 147 and they believed, and We gave them enjoyment for awhile. 148 Then ask them whether your Lord has daughters and they have sons. 149 Or that We created the angels female, and they are witnesses (thereto)? 150 Is it not of their own calumny that they say, 151 "Allah has begotten off spring or children (i.e. angels are the daughters of Allah)?" And, verily, they are liars! 152 Has He chosen daughters above sons? 153 “What is the matter with you? What sort of a judgement you impose!” 154 Will you then not take heed? 155 Or have you a clear authority? 156 Then produce your scripture, if you should be truthful. 157 They have set up a kinship between Him and the jinn; and the jinn know that they shall be arraigned. 158 Hallowed be Allah from that which they ascribe to Him. 159 Except the chosen bondmen of Allah. 160 So you and your deities 161 can cause anyone to fall prey to your temptation 162 Save him who will go to hell. 163 [The angels say], "There is not among us any except that he has a known position. 164 We are surely those who are arranged in ranks. 165 and we are of those who glorify Allah.” 166 Even though they (unbelievers) say, 167 If we had the account of earlier people with us, 168 then were we God's sincere servants.' 169 They have rejected the Quran. They will soon know the consequences (of their disbelief). 170 We have already given Our promise to Our Messengers 171 [That] indeed, they would be those given victory 172 and that it is Our host that would certainly triumph. 173 So turn thou away from them for a little while, 174 and watch them. They, too, will watch. 175 Do they really wish to hasten Our punishment? 176 When it descends into their courtyard, it will be terrible for those who have already been warned. 177 Withdraw from them awhile 178 and see [them for what they are]; and in time they [too] will come to see [what they do not see now]. 179 Too glorious is your Lord, the Lord of power, for what they ascribe to Him. 180 And peace be on the apostles. 181 And Praise to Allah, the Lord and Cherisher of the Worlds. 182
True are the words of God the Almighty.
End of Surah: The Arrangers (Al-Saaffaat). Sent down in Mecca after Animals (Al-An 'aam) before Luqmaan (Luqmaan)
